    Learn more about Building Technology Master's degree programs in Spain

    Studying a Master's in Building Technology in Spain offers you a dynamic opportunity to engage in advanced concepts essential for modern construction and infrastructure. This degree emphasizes sustainable practices and innovative techniques that respond to evolving industry needs.

    In your Master's program, you'll delve into areas like energy-efficient building design, construction management, and the integration of smart technologies. Common courses include sustainable materials analysis and advanced structural engineering, which equip you with the skills to address current environmental challenges and optimize building performance. As students explore these topics, they strengthen their critical thinking and problem-solving abilities.

    The Spanish educational system often features a practical focus, encouraging collaboration with industry professionals through projects and internships. Graduates of these programs emerge ready for international opportunities, equipped with knowledge that applies globally. An emphasis on research and hands-on experience prepares you for roles in project management, building consultancy, or sustainable design, contributing to developments that prioritize ecological and societal impact.
